Output e2a8c79ed55a2793832e50d7da263d73d88a4942499ceea891fbe3aedca6a5ba:0

value
11539009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e0466879729a3529500e4addb4b39e8b71eadf OP_EQUAL
address
3QCNpdsBQT4CpAdsQdnX1yTXoLYwXJkMxo
transaction
e2a8c79ed55a2793832e50d7da263d73d88a4942499ceea891fbe3aedca6a5ba
confirmations
257343
spent
true